Races of the New World
Far across the arctic sea that divides the old world from the new lies a continent of peoples wholly apart from the bloodlines of the Empire. Discovered by the explorer Elizabeth and chronicled by Dothus Petri, Emissary to the New World, these beastfolk are not Twisted Races nor Half Bloods, but native peoples of their own land - each with its own ancestral tongue, bound loosely together by the shared trade pidgin of Beastspeech.
The first old-world foothold on the continent is the settlement of Acadia, whose relations with the surrounding beastfolk range from daily trade to wary nonviolence pacts to open danger in the deep swamps.
The Peoples
| People | Nature |
|---|---|
| Canidae | Wolf-folk; roaming apex pack-hunters |
| Caprini | Goat-folk; sheltered village farmers |
| Bejorn | Bear-folk (Ursine); fierce tribal warriors |
| Reepicheep | Mouse-folk; communal keepers of lore |
| Felixpes | Rabbit-folk; cautious and lucky |
| Grung | Frog-folk; poisonous swamp casteborn |
| Lizardfolk | Watchful, reclusive swamp-dwellers |
| Ludai | Slug-folk; secretive mollusk farmers |
| Thanoi | Walrus-folk; tireless arctic builders |
| Leonin | Lion-folk; proud tribal warriors |
Other beastfolk are recorded in the explorers’ notes but not yet detailed - the monkey-like Vanara, the Rhinox, and the fox- and badger-kin Vulpini among them.
Language
Almost every people of the New World speaks its own ancestral tongue alongside Beastspeech, the broad-but-shallow trade pidgin that lets otherwise isolated peoples bargain, parley, and warn one another. Few speak the Common of the old world.
